Best for: Empathetic support in personal injury and estate matters
Brandy Austin Law Firm is noted for providing empathetic support and detailed consultations, which stand out positively across multiple reviews. However, numerous complaints regarding communication issues, unexpected fees, and unsatisfactory case management negatively impact the business's overall reputation. The contrast between positive experiences with specific staff and negative encounters with the firm as a whole contributes to its mixed reviews.
What reviewers consistently mention
Several reviewers highlight the compassionate and attentive service provided by staff, particularly citing positive interactions with individuals like Trey and Darian, who helped guide clients through difficult processes.
Multiple customers express satisfaction with the firm’s thoroughness in legal consultations, noting that attorneys and staff effectively communicated details and processes, making clients feel informed and supported.
Watch out for
Several reviewers report significant dissatisfaction with the firm's communication and responsiveness, mentioning long delays and unreturned calls throughout their cases.
Multiple customers describe experiences of feeling misled about fees and retainer amounts, with claims that unexpected costs arose and services were not delivered as promised, leading to feelings of being taken advantage of.
